JoeSmith wrote: Hi Heimiko,
if that name would be used in the sabnzb queue, because when searching for foreign stuff you sometimes get the wrong results (that you don't notice when it just says seriesname S0xE0x) - so it would be better if it would show the result from the search engine and use that name.
on second thought, there's already some code in the auto downloader that should do that, but not yet functioning.
did you notice the %T in the friendly name setting in the auto downloader episode dialog?
that %T should fill in the text which comes after the serie name and episode numbers, as found in the downloaded NZB,
I think this is exactly what you meant to ask.  so this has already been thought of, and will come with V2 ;-)

Hi!

This looks very nice, but unfortunately it has a serious problem: when selecting more than one item from the search results and then clicking "Add to SABnzbd+'s queue", it will only download and add the first item and not all that are selected! This is a serious problem, because most large postings consist of several parts.

On http://www.nzbindex.nl/ I can also select several items from the search results and add them all as one new download to SABnzbd+ and this feature is absolutely necessary. Even if you only download small TV episodes, It'd also be nice to be able to combine many into one download (SABnzbd+ fully supports that and will extract all episodes correctly).

So your program is a nice concept, but unfortunately unusable in the current form. I hope you'll fix that one issue so this could be a great companion program toSABnzbd+.
